Fate of aflatoxins B1 and G 1 residues during biscuit processing.

Abstract

Effect of biscuit processing on the destruction of aflatoxins B1 and G1 with and/or without some commonly leavening agents used namely sodium bicarbonate, ammonium bicarbonate and sodium bisulfite and sodium chloride.It was found that mixing step reduced the concentration of aflatoxins B1 and G1 by 80.7% and 82.7%, while the effect of baking step being 28.9% and 21.5%. The effect of mixing was found to be more pronounced than that baking step.The highest destruction effect on aflatoxin B1 was observed by adding a mixture composed of sodium and ammonium bicarbonate and sodium bisulfite followed by sodium chloride, sodium bisulfite, ammonium bicarbonate and/or sodium bicarbonate alone, where the reduction values of toxin after mixing were 93.4,91.9,91.7, 88.8 and 86.6% respectively, while the baking effect ranged 17.2 to 34.5% in the presence of different leaving agents added.Concerning aflatoxin G1; the highest destructive effect of toxin was adsorbed by adding a mixture of sodium and ammonium bicarbonate and sodium bisulfite followed by sodium bisulfite, sodium chloride, ammonium bicarbonate and/or sodium bicarbonate alone since the destruction values of such toxin after mixing were 96.2%, 92.8%, 92.6%, 89.0% and 87.7% respectively, while the baking effect ranged 20.9 to 34.5% in all leavening agents added.
